Guy Novak, Sr Principal Program Cost and Schedule Control Analyst and EVM/Agile trainer, delivers a practical tour of the Integrated Master Schedule (IMS)—what it’s for, how it ties scope to time, and why the Critical Path (CP) is the backbone of reliable metrics and forecasts. You’ll learn what the IMS uniquely provides—an integrated, time-phased network linking scope, logic, and resources to support credible forecasting and what-if analysis—and how to read it for decision value while balancing cost and schedule views. Guy will demonstrate a dynamic CP, seeing how status, logic changes, and risk treatments can shift the driving path while monitoring and reporting CP health. You will learn to spot when a CAM is popular for the wrong reasons (green charts driven by soft logic, hidden lags, and back-loading), manage schedule margin as the schedule counterpart to EAC by planning, protecting, and tracking margin burn, and decide, as a PM, when it tells the story and when the CP does to align cost and schedule metrics when it looks fine but the CP is slipping.
